Ok I was wanting to know if anyone know about the NP208 transfer case. The t case in my truck 84 w150 work fine other then it will not go into 4lo. I have read how to adjust the linkage but also read that in these t cases if 4 lo is not used often it can rust and not allow it to work. When I first bought the truck it had gear oil in it and was about 2 quarts low. I drained and refilled with the recommended fluid.
 
Disconnect the shifter and see if you can move the lever on the t case through all it's ranges, block the wheels because if put the t case in neutral the truck will roll. Two quarts low on that transfer case is just about empty.
 
agreed, two quarts low is empty. should be atf, not gear oil. the low range fork is wore out.
 
Now I don't know if Chrysler is like GM in this way. I'm certainly not saying this is what you should do. I've seen GM owners kick the shift lever into 4 low range and afterwards it worked fine. Around here it rarely snows so there's a bunch of 4X4 s on the streets that never get exercised.
 
it held about 3.5 qts of atf when I refilled it I also herd just slamming it into gear fixes it. I am going to try adjusting the shifter first when I get the time.
